filmov
tv
Evolution of Programming Languages: Top 10 Programming language from 2004 to 2022

Показать описание
Python (2004-2022): Python has gained immense popularity due to its simplicity, readability, and versatility. It's widely used for web development, scientific computing, data analysis, and automation. Python's extensive libraries, such as NumPy and TensorFlow, have made it a top choice for machine learning and AI applications.
Java (2004-2022): Java has been a dominant programming language for many years. It's known for its platform independence, robustness, and extensive libraries. Java is widely used for building enterprise-level applications, Android apps, and large-scale systems.
C++ (2004-2022): C++ is a powerful and versatile programming language. It's known for its performance and efficiency, making it popular for system-level programming, game development, and resource-constrained applications. C++ offers low-level control and high-level abstractions.
C# (2004-2022): C# (pronounced C sharp) is a general-purpose language developed by Microsoft. It's commonly used for developing Windows applications, web services, and games using the Unity game engine. C# is similar to Java and offers a rich framework called .NET for building applications.
PHP (2004-2022): PHP (Hypertext Preprocessor) was one of the most popular languages for web development during this period. It's designed for server-side scripting and is often used with databases to create dynamic websites. However, its popularity declined in later years with the rise of JavaScript frameworks and other languages.
R (2004-2022): R is a language and environment for statistical computing and graphics. It's widely used in data analysis, machine learning, and statistical modeling. R provides a comprehensive set of tools for manipulating and visualizing data, making it popular among data scientists and statisticians.
Objective-C (2004-2014): Objective-C was the primary programming language used for iOS and macOS app development before the introduction of Swift. It's a superset of the C programming language with added object-oriented features. Objective-C was widely used for building Apple ecosystem applications.
Swift (2014-2022): Swift was introduced by Apple as a modern programming language for iOS and macOS development. It offers a cleaner syntax, type safety, and memory management, replacing Objective-C as the preferred language for Apple ecosystem development.
Kotlin (2004-2022): Kotlin is a statically typed programming language that runs on the Java Virtual Machine (JVM). It's designed to be fully interoperable with Java and offers several modern features and enhanced productivity. Kotlin gained popularity as the official language for Android app development, providing an alternative to Java.
It's worth noting that some languages on the list, like PHP and Objective-C, experienced changes in their popularity and usage patterns over time, while others, like R and Kotlin, saw significant growth and adoption within their respective domains.
Thank You
Java (2004-2022): Java has been a dominant programming language for many years. It's known for its platform independence, robustness, and extensive libraries. Java is widely used for building enterprise-level applications, Android apps, and large-scale systems.
C++ (2004-2022): C++ is a powerful and versatile programming language. It's known for its performance and efficiency, making it popular for system-level programming, game development, and resource-constrained applications. C++ offers low-level control and high-level abstractions.
C# (2004-2022): C# (pronounced C sharp) is a general-purpose language developed by Microsoft. It's commonly used for developing Windows applications, web services, and games using the Unity game engine. C# is similar to Java and offers a rich framework called .NET for building applications.
PHP (2004-2022): PHP (Hypertext Preprocessor) was one of the most popular languages for web development during this period. It's designed for server-side scripting and is often used with databases to create dynamic websites. However, its popularity declined in later years with the rise of JavaScript frameworks and other languages.
R (2004-2022): R is a language and environment for statistical computing and graphics. It's widely used in data analysis, machine learning, and statistical modeling. R provides a comprehensive set of tools for manipulating and visualizing data, making it popular among data scientists and statisticians.
Objective-C (2004-2014): Objective-C was the primary programming language used for iOS and macOS app development before the introduction of Swift. It's a superset of the C programming language with added object-oriented features. Objective-C was widely used for building Apple ecosystem applications.
Swift (2014-2022): Swift was introduced by Apple as a modern programming language for iOS and macOS development. It offers a cleaner syntax, type safety, and memory management, replacing Objective-C as the preferred language for Apple ecosystem development.
Kotlin (2004-2022): Kotlin is a statically typed programming language that runs on the Java Virtual Machine (JVM). It's designed to be fully interoperable with Java and offers several modern features and enhanced productivity. Kotlin gained popularity as the official language for Android app development, providing an alternative to Java.
It's worth noting that some languages on the list, like PHP and Objective-C, experienced changes in their popularity and usage patterns over time, while others, like R and Kotlin, saw significant growth and adoption within their respective domains.
Thank You